Sea Grant Community Extension
The University of Hawai‘i Sea Grant College Program (UH Sea Grant) works for the people of Hawai‘i.
It funds targeted, leading-edge research on the challenges and opportunities facing our coastal communities. Extension faculty apply the results of this research to improve our quality of life, now and for future generations.
Private gifts support many programs that impact our community
- Outreach to keep Hawai‘i safe during natural hazards, including authoring and distributing over 50,000 copies of the Homeowners Handbook to Prepare for Natural Hazards.
- Protecting our environment by educating over one million people each year about coral reefs, marine mammals and sea turtles in our Hanauma Bay Education Program.
- Empowering local Hawai‘i communities to manage their own nearshore resources leading to local bans on collecting wild fish for the aquarium trade.
- Promotion of sustainable energy and water use in buildings through testing and application of new technologies.
